After eight years of break, the admission test for Honours 1st Year Admission under National University begins today, May 31, 2025. The exam is conducting at 879 centers in 64 district cities of the country. The MCQ Type exam will be continue till 12 PM.
As per the report, about 6,00,000 students from all over the country have applied for Honours Admission session 2024-25. However, a total of 5,60,595 applicants are selected for the admission test. Interested candidates will be participating the admission test in the college mentioned in the admit card.
National University conducted the admission test last time 8 years ago for the session 2014-25. Candidates were admitted after passing on the test. Next year, the admission system were changed. The students (session 2015-16) were admitted based on their GPA on SSC and HSC Examination.
The authority has announced that, they will conduct the admission test from 2024-25 session. As a result, National University has released the admission circular with new guideline.
NU Admission Test 2025: Mark Distribution
According to the syllabus issued by university, there will be 100 marks in the test. Among them, 20 for Bangla, 20 for English, and 20 for General Knowledge. On the other hand, there will be 40 marks separately for each group.
The good news is; there will be no nagative marking system. So, if the candidates submit wrong answer, no mark will be cut from the total marks. Candidates will need to get at least 35 marks to pass the admission test.
Total Seats
The Honours Course is available in 881 colleges under National University. Among them, 264 are Govt and 617 are Non-Govt College. As per the official report, there was 4,36,285 seats in the Honours Course for the session 2022-23. On the other hand, there was 4,21,990 seats for Degree Pass and Certificate Course.
